编程输入一个正整数n,寻找小于等于n的数中因子个数最大的数。
输入:20
输出:
12的因子数6最大
编程输入一个正整数n,统计并打印小于等于n的每个数的因子个数。 输入...
printf("%d 因子数%d\\n",i,k+1);} return 0;}
编写一个c程序,接收一个整数输入,然后显示所有小于等于该数的素数
system("pause") or input loop *\/int main(void) {int dec,a,b;int inword=1;printf("enter a integrate:");scanf("%d",&dec);if(dec<=0)printf("enter doc>0 ");else if(dec==1) printf("sushu :1\\n");else
...用户输入一个正整数n计算所有小于等于n的正整数之和?
可以使用以下Python代码实现该功能:```python n = int(input("请输入一个正整数n:")) # 获取用户输入的正整数n sum = 0 # 初始化总和为0 for i in range(1, n + 1): # 遍历1到n之间的正整数 sum += i # 累加每个正整数到总和中 print("所有小于等于n的正整数之和为:",...
编程实现,输入一个自然数n,输出n以内的所有素数。
n = int(input("请输入一个自然数:"))primes = find_primes(n)print("小于等于", n, "的素数有:", primes)运行示例:Copy code 请输入一个自然数:20 小于等于 20 的素数有: [2, 3, 5, 7, 11, 13, 17, 19]
用C语言编写程序从键盘输入一个正整数数n,输出n!
int n, result;printf("请输入一个正整数:");scanf("%d", &n);result = factorial(n);printf("%d! = %d\\n", n, result);return 0;} 递归函数`factorial`根据定义,当n小于或等于1时返回1,否则返回n乘以(n-1)的阶乘。在主函数`main`中,读取用户输入的n,然后调用`factorial`计算n的...
...每组数据两行。 第一行包含一个正整数n(小于等
1、首先打开visual studio软件,新建一个C语言文件。2、接着在C语言文件的顶部导入库内容。3、接着运用scanf函数接收用户输入的字符串。4、然后我们利用printf函数打印一下用户输入的内容。5、运行程序以后就会弹出如下图所示的CMD界面,我们输入内容就会自动接收到,然后原样输出内容。6、最后如果你接收...
用java编写一个程序,实现键盘上输入一个整数n。
public class InputN { public static void main(String[] args) { Scanner scan = new Scanner(System.in);System.out.print("请输入一个数:");int n = scan.nextInt();int sum = 0;if (n <= 1) { System.out.println("整数n应该为大于1的正整数");} else { for (int i = 0...
如何用C语言编写程序输入一个正整数n,编程序输出从2到n间的所有完数...
C语言实现如下:include<stdio.h>void main(){int i,j,k,n;scanf("%d",&n); \/\/输入一个正整数nfor(i=2;i<=n;i++){k=0;for(j=1;j<=i-1;j++)if(i%j==0) k+=j;if(k==i) printf("%d\\n",i);\/\/判断i的所有真因子之和是否等于i,是则输出i。}}注意:建议n的取值...
C语言循环语句输入一个正数n 计算小于等于n的所有能被3整除的数的和
int calc(int n){ int res;while(n--)if(n%3 == 0)res += n;return res;}
c++程序:通过键盘输入一个正整数n,求出平方值小于n的正整数并输出
include<stdio.h> void main(){ int i,n; \/\/定义i,n printf("输入N:");scanf("%d",&n); \/\/输入n的值 for(i=1;i*i<n;i++) \/\/i的值等于1,i的平方小于n,i自增1 { printf("%d\\t",i); \/\/输出i的值~} printf("\\n");} ...